THE GREATEST SHOWMAN

(2017) PG ● Sunday, 7pm, Ch4 ★★★★ Here’s a film with one purpose and one purpose only: to make you feel good. It’s a fictionali­sed musical version of the life of Phineas Taylor Barnum, a 19th-century showman and entreprene­ur who took circus from sideshow to mainstream entertainm­ent, popularisi­ng a crowd-pleasing format and acts that still thrive today in TV shows such as Britain’s Got Talent. Hugh Jackman’s Barnum (above) is a charming, upbeat fellow (the real P.T. Barnum was rather more complex) who builds his travelling show from scratch, with loyal wife Charity (Michelle Williams) at his side. Barnum goes on to make a mint, but in this version of his story, it happens only with the support of his loyal circus family – bearded ladies, freaks and all.

IN THE HEAT OF THE NIGHT

(1967) 15 ◆ Saturday, 12.10am, BBC2 ★★★★★

Sidney Poitier broke through the race barrier in Hollywood as the first black actor to win an Oscar, for Lilies Of The Field in 1964, and in this crime thriller, his character faces racism head on. Passing through a small Mississipp­i town, Poitier’s Virgil Tibbs (above) is picked up by police not long after the murder of a businessma­n. As a black man with dollars in his pocket, Virgil – or should that be Mr Tibbs? – is their prime suspect. At the station, he is calm and dignified, in contrast to shouty, slouchy police chief Gillespie (an Oscar-winning Rod Steiger). Virgil isn’t just the wrong man, he’s a Philadelph­ia police officer and a homicide expert. Reluctantl­y, he stays to assist with the case, keeping his cool in the face of prejudice and suspicion.

STRICTLY COME DANCING

7.50PM, BBC1 ★★★★★ Prepare for socially distanced sparkle as Strictly returns. Yes, there will be Covid changes – audiences will be cut back, dancers and celebs will form ‘support bubbles’, Bruno Tonioli won’t be in the studio with his fellow judges and so on – but the glittery heart of the show remains unchanged. Tonight, this year’s sequinclad stars discover who their profession­al partners are going to be. The big question is: Who’s going to dance with Olympic gold medal-winning boxer Nicola Adams (right) in the show’s first-ever same-sex couple? All will be revealed…

THE SHINING (1980) 15

9.15PM, BBC2 ★★★★★ One of the best Stephen King adaptation­s, this is not that faithful to its source (and King wasn’t happy), but Stanley Kubrick invests his psychologi­cal supernatur­al thriller with visual flair and buckets of menace. Jack Nicholson is the dad losing his grip in the Overlook Hotel.

SHARPE’S RIFLES

11.20AM, DRAMA ★★★★

The Sharpe series was a tougher, grittier propositio­n to begin with, as this first-ever episode from 1993 shows. Sharpe’s Rifles finds Sean Bean’s risen-from-the-ranks officer (left) struggling to avoid being murdered by his new charges, let alone lead them.

IN REBECCA’S FOOTSTEPS

1PM, PBS AMERICA ★★★

This profile paints a picture of how the life of Daphne du Maurier (left), was split between her prolific work as an author and as Lady Browning, accompanyi­ng Sir Frederick to highsociet­y events. If you’re a fan of her thriller Rebecca, Netflix has a new film of it from Wednesday.

ARCHIVE ON 4: PLAY FOR TODAY

8PM, RADIO 4 HHHHH

It’s 50 years since the groundbrea­king drama series Play For Today launched on BBC TV (it ran from 1970 to 1984). To mark the occasion, actress Alison Steadman – who starred in classics such as Abigail’s Party and Nuts In May – presents this look back at the oneoff dramas, with contributi­ons from many of the greats involved, including the directors Mike Leigh and Ken Loach, and the actress Maureen Lipman.
